Introduction:
The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ers (USACE), Los Angeles District (SPL) has requirements to provide Design Build (DB) construction services in support of its minor construction program (Sustainment, Restoration, and Modernization (SRM), and minor MILCON) programs, supporting Military Installations, International and Interagency Support-IIS.
Coverage Area(s):
Contract Specifics:
The anticipates issuing two DB contract that will be for a period of five years and/or $99,000,000, whichever occurs first. The intent is to issue one contract each for the geographical coverage area(s) specified herein. Accordingly, SPL proposes to award at least three but no more than five firm-fixed price (FFP) individual Indefinite Delivery Contracts (IDCs) and subsequent FFP Task Orders (TOs) with the proposed aggregate capacity to provide professional Design Build Construction Services under North American Industrial Classification System (NAICS) Code 236220, Commercial and Institutional Building Construction.
Task order Limits:
Minimum: $ 1,000,000.00
Maximum: $10,000,000.00
Sustainment, Restoration, and Modernization (SRM) type work includes the following:
The Facilities Sustainment, Restoration, and Modernization (SRM) program is a Department of Defense (DoD) program (including other SPL Supported Programs) that funds the maintenance, repair, and modernization of facilities:
Routine maintenance and repair to keep facilities in good working order. This includes:
Major renovation or reconstruction to keep facilities modern and relevant. This includes replacing major systems or components that are excessively complex or impact other systems and equipment.
Alterations to facilities to implement new or higher standards or to accommodate new functions or missions.
The SRM program can also include a demolition program to fund the dismantling and disposal of obsolete and excess structures.
Minor MILCON
A minor military construction project is a military construction project that is for a single undertaking at a military installation and has an approved cost equal to, or less than, the amount specified by law as the maximum amount of a minor military construction project.
IIS Programs
IIS is the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ers (Corps) program providing technical assistance to non-Department of Defense (DoD) federal agencies, state and local governments, tribal nations, private U.S. firms, international organizations, and foreign governments. The Corps provides engineering and construction services, environmental restoration, management of water and land related natural resources, relief and recovery work, energy conservation work, and other management and technical services.

North American Industrial Classification Code
236220 Commercial and Institutional Building Construction
This industry comprises establishments primarily responsible for the construction (including new work, additions, alterations, maintenance, and repairs) of commercial and institutional buildings and related structures, such as stadiums, grain elevators, and indoor swimming facilities. This industry includes establishments responsible for the on-site assembly of modular or prefabricated commercial and institutional buildings. Included in this industry are commercial and institutional building general contractors, commercial and institutional building for-sale builders, commercial and institutional building design-build firms, and commercial and institutional building project construction management firms.
